CHLOROPHYTA : Bryopsidales : CodiaceaeGREEN ALGAE

Codium tomentosum Stackhouse


Description: Thallus dichotomously branched, terete, to over 20 cms long with a felt-like surface and spongy feel. Utricles with rounded apices.

Habitat: Uncommon. Epilithic in rock pools of the lower littoral.

Distribution: Mainly on the western shores of the British Isles. Europe: Mediterranean, Azores, Portugal, Spain, France, Netherlands and Norway. Further afield: Sri Lanka and Japan.

Similar Species: Othere species of Codium save C. adhaerens and C.bursa.

Key Identification Features:

  • Dichotomous branching. Utricles with rounded apices.
